Gateway NV79C48u


$700.00 Released September, 2010

Product Shot 1 The Pros:Boots up and is ready to use in under a minute. Screen brightness is very high, can handle any environment. HDMI connection is easy to work with, hassle-free, no special settings needed.

The Cons:A little too heavy to carry around with you everywhere. Not enough graphics processing power to run games past low-to-medium settings.

The Gateway NV79C48u puts an emphasis on sleek visuals for both the interior and exterior with a 2.4GHz Intel Core i3-370M processor, Intel HD graphics, and a 17.3" Widescreen Ultrabright HD display, making it an ideal choice for casual gamers or for those who want to enjoy their media in high definition.

Using Hyper-threading, virtualization and trusted-execution technologies with a 3MB smart cache, the Intel Processor can handle multiple tasks simultaneously, while the Intel HD graphics tackles advanced 3D graphics and delivers high-quality, high-definition playback. The 17.3" display provides an immersive experience for games or movies in 16:9 aspect ratio using 4GB of DDR3 RAM, while 500GB of hard drive storage ensures users will be hard-pressed to run out of space. Also included are multimedia features such as a Multi-in-1 Media Reader, 3 USB ports, an HDMI port, an Integrated Webcam, and an 8x-SuperMulti DL drive. The NV79C48u operates on Genuine Windows 7 Home Premium.

Features:

  • 2.4GHz Intel Core i3-370M processor with 3MB smartcache
  • Intel HD graphics
  • 4GB DDR3 RAM
  • 17.3" Widescreen Ultrabright HD display with 16:9 aspect ratio
  • 500GB SATA hard drive
  • Multi-in-1 Media Reader
  • 3 USB 2.0 ports
  • Integrated Webcam
  • 8x-SuperMulti DL drive
  • Genuine Windows 7 Home Premium operating system
